    Abstract: A method and apparatus for correcting doppler shifts in synthetic aperture radar data. More particularly, in an optical correlator (10) for synthetic aperture radar data having a means for directing a laser beam (22) at a signal film (12) having radar return pulse intensity information recorded thereon, a resultant laser beam (32) then passing through a range telescope (34), an azimuth telescope (38), and a Fourier transform filter (36) located between the range and azimuth telescopes, thereby forming an image for recordation on an image film (40), a compensation means for doppler shift in the radar return pulse intensity information includes a beam splitter (46) for reflecting the modulated laser beam, after having passed through the Fourier transform filter (36), to a detection screen (48) having two photodiodes (66 and 68) mounted thereon. The photodiodes are positioned on each side of the Gaussian distribution of the Fourier transform spectrum reflected by the beam splitter (46).
